Scientific Backing and Therapeutic Use
The therapeutic results of painting are not only anecdotal—They're increasingly supported by a growing body of scientific research and scientific observe. Studies during the fields of psychology, neuroscience, and artwork therapy persistently spotlight the benefits of Inventive expression on mental health and fitness, demonstrating that portray can be quite a useful Instrument for psychological therapeutic, self-regulation, and psychological resilience.
Neuroscientific investigation has demonstrated that engaging in creative functions like painting stimulates various areas with the brain related to emotion, memory, and trouble-fixing. It can also enhance the manufacture of dopamine, a neurotransmitter accountable for satisfaction, determination, and target. For people handling depression or panic—situations frequently characterised by lower dopamine ranges—portray provides a organic and fulfilling technique to activate these truly feel-fantastic chemical substances.
Artwork therapy, a professional discipline combining psychology and artistic follow, makes use of portray as well as other Visible arts to assist persons process trauma, cope with psychological sickness, and increase overall psychological nicely-currently being. Trained art therapists tutorial clients as a result of certain physical exercises that encourage self-expression, reflection, and healing. These periods are Utilized in diverse settings, like hospitals, rehabilitation facilities, colleges, and mental overall health clinics, and possess revealed good outcomes for people with PTSD, panic Conditions, melancholy, and even neurodegenerative illnesses like dementia.
Several medical experiments support these methods. As an illustration, exploration posted during the Arts in Psychotherapy has shown that just forty five minutes of artwork-producing can substantially lessen cortisol degrees, your body’s Key strain hormone. Other experiments have discovered that people who interact in standard painting sessions report higher self-awareness, enhanced temper, and also a more robust perception of intent and id.
The scientific consensus is obvious: painting is far more than a hobby. It is actually a robust, proof-primarily based intervention that may Perform a meaningful job in psychological overall health treatment method and emotional self-care.
